Carolina Hurricanes News & Notes:
The Hurricanes are coming off a 4-3 win over the Winnipeg Jets on Friday. The Canes are 31st in power play in the NHL at 13.6 percent.
Buffalo Sabres News & Notes:
The Sabres have won three of their last four games after a 9-3 drubbing of the Chicago Blackhawks on Friday. Buffalo has the NHL’s top-ranked penalty kill at 88.5 percent.\

Players To Watch:
Carolina Hurricanes
Sebastian Aho leads the Hurricanes with 21 points. Seth Jarvis has collected 18 points.
Buffalo Sabres
Tage Thompson has collected 20 points for the Sabres. Alex Tuch also has 20 points and collected four assists on Friday.
